Job description

Role Overview

Aramark Ireland is hiring a Kitchen Porter to support catering operations at University Hospital Galway in Galway, County Galway, Ireland. This role plays an important part in patient meal production and in providing a warm, attentive service experience for patients using the hospital’s facilities. The position is well suited to someone who is motivated, focused, and interested in joining a catering team that supports patient feeding services.

This opportunity offers evening work and requires working only every second weekend. Full-time hours are available.

Key Duties

  • Keep kitchen utensils, cooking pots, and trays stocked and ready for use.
  • Work to maintain excellent food safety and hygiene standards across the kitchen and related areas, following direction from the Head Chef.
  • Complete any food safety and quality checks or records assigned to you each day without exception.
  • Upkeep cleanliness and hygiene standards for the building, kitchen spaces, and personal presentation.
  • Support onsite deliveries from the main kitchen to ward kitchens.
  • Take on reasonable additional duties that help with service delivery, food preparation, hygiene, and overall kitchen efficiency.

What the Employer Offers

  • Every second weekend off.
  • Competitive pay, including time-and-a-third on Sundays and enhanced pay for bank holidays.
  • Meals provided during working hours.
  • Uniform and shoes supplied.
  • Opportunities to grow and progress within the company.
  • Basic induction and further training opportunities.
  • Sick pay.
  • Access to a company pension scheme.

Requirements

  • Prior experience in a similar role within a busy catering environment.
  • A solid background in hospitality or catering is an advantage.
  • Good time management skills.
  • Working knowledge of food hygiene standards, including HACCP, is preferred.
  • A practical, solutions-focused mindset with a flexible and positive approach.
  • Garda vetting is required for this position.
  • A full Category B driving licence is required.
